    My 1995 Ranger was just totaled and I am ready to get another (rear-ended by a Dodge Ram - my old truck took all the punishment and kept my wife safe, but there is just too much damage to fix). My '95 was a 4x4 V6 with oversize tires that sat up nice and tall, but most of the new factory Rangers seem diminutive in comparison. Any advice for getting something new/nearly new with a more aggressive look? One option that I am trying to avoid is to do some aftermarket mud tires or lift, but I'd rather find something already done so I can see the finished product before I buy. Also, I don't want to pay for the factory tires and then new tires immediately after. Other tips for packages or options that are must haves or I should stay away from?

    you cant get a brand new ranger anymore....but look for an FX4 level 2 they come factory with 31s and the pre 08s sit higher than the 08s-11s
